History

It was founded in 1987 and was named as SK Polissya Chernihiv. In 1992 the club was renamed into Lehenda Chernihiv. Also the club was named as Lehenda-Cheksil Chernihiv and Lehenda-ShVSM Chernihiv. The team currently playing in the Ukrainian Women's League

In the 2000 season they have won their first Championship. In the 2001–02, 2003–04, 2006–07 seasons they played in the UEFA Women's Cup
